mapi: Hack around glGetInternalformativ not being hidden in GLES
This is hella ugly. The same-named function in desktop OpenGL is hidden, but it needs to be exposed by libGLESv2 for OpenGL ES 3.0. There's no way to express in the XML that a function should be be hidden in one API but exposed in another. This won't affect any change now, but it will prevent a regression in a later patch.
